    Separatists think they’ll win a vote they’re poised to lose by a wide margin, according to an exclusive new poll. With a little more than five weeks to go before Alberta’s fall referendum, host Kathleen Petty explains how the heck we got here and where we’re headed next.


    David Coletto, CEO of Abacus Data, does a deep dive into Alberta public opinion. His numbers say if the referendum was held today, Albertans would vote decisively to remain. Motivations for the other side aren’t clearcut. Do they actually want to leave? How many just want to send Ottawa a message? Danielle Smith says she wants to have this vote and move on, but can we?


    University of Calgary political scientist Lisa Young has also been tracking the rise of separatist sentiment and western alienation in Alberta since it flared up following the 2019 re-election of Justin Trudeau. She helps analyze the data, and questions whether polls might be systematically under-estimating separatist support.

    Alberta Premier Danielle Smith and Ontario Premier Doug Ford are using very different tactics in the ongoing Canada-U.S. trade war. As Smith travels to Nashville, we ask whether her kill them with kindness approach is working. And Alberta’s senior representative in Washington, Nathan Cooper, weighs in on the delicate dance of diplomacy in Donald Trump’s America.


    To put it all in context, two conservative insiders join host Kathleen Petty. Evan Menzies worked with the United Conservative Party, and before that with Smith during the early days of the Wildrose Party. Cole Hogan helped get both Doug Ford and former Alberta premier Jason Kenney elected. Together, they break down the politics behind the premiers' actions and whether these strategies will make headway toward renewed trade talks or at least less punishing tariffs.

    Putting oil and gas on the bargaining table as the U.S.-Canada trade war heats up would pour gasoline on Alberta’s fall referendum. At least that’s what one separatist leader, Keith Wilson, is arguing. This week we ask Wilson why he thinks the trade war means Albertans should push for a binding referendum on separation in October.


    After that, journalists Tyler Dawson from the Globe and Mail and the Toronto Star’s Richard Warnica weigh in with host Kathleen Petty on some major questions: how will the trade war influence the referendum campaign? What's the likelihood oil will be used as a cudgel in this dispute? And who comes out ahead when everyone from Doug Ford to Mark Carney to Danielle Smith is talking trade and unity?
